--- Begin Message ---
- To: Debian Bug Tracking System <submit@bugs.debian.org>
- Subject: kmail: segfault with IMAP in KMFolder::unGetMsg
- From: Marcus Better <marcus@better.se>
- Date: Sat, 28 Jul 2007 23:38:16 +0200 (CEST)
- Message-id: <20070728213816.E26091501@kelev.home.better.se>
Package: kmail
Version: 4:3.5.7-2
Severity: important
I hit this while reading mail from an IMAP account. When I opened the
folder, there was some sync bug where one of the mails was displayed
twice. I pressed F5 to refresh and one of the lines went away, but
when I selected the remaining message in the index, it crashed.
Using host libthread_db library "/lib/libthread_db.so.1".
[Thread debugging using libthread_db enabled]
[New Thread 47992987440496 (LWP 11356)]
[New Thread 1107310928 (LWP 11362)]
[New Thread 1098918224 (LWP 11361)]
[New Thread 1090525520 (LWP 11360)]
[New Thread 1082132816 (LWP 11359)]
[KCrash handler]
#5 KMFolder::unGetMsg (this=0x0, idx=-1)
at /build/buildd/kdepim-3.5.7/./kmail/kmfolder.cpp:316
#6 0x00002ba632f5f5a7 in KMAcctImap::slotFilterMsg (this=0xa4aa10,
msg=0x107f910) at /build/buildd/kdepim-3.5.7/./kmail/kmacctimap.cpp:617
#7 0x00002ba632fdc424 in KMAcctImap::qt_invoke (this=0xa4aa10, _id=28,
_o=0x7fff781b0140) at ./kmacctimap.moc:121
#8 0x00002ba63499e4ee in QObject::activate_signal (this=0x1003b10,
clist=0x1032990, o=0x7fff781b0140) at kernel/qobject.cpp:2356
#9 0x00002ba632da5452 in KMail::FolderJob::messageRetrieved (
this=<value optimized out>, t0=0x107f910) at ./folderjob.moc:129
#10 0x00002ba632fab1a7 in KMail::ImapJob::slotGetMessageResult (
this=0x1003b10, job=<value optimized out>)
at /build/buildd/kdepim-3.5.7/./kmail/imapjob.cpp:444
#11 0x00002ba632ff3b3f in KMail::ImapJob::qt_invoke (this=0x1003b10, _id=2,
_o=0x7fff781b02f0) at ./imapjob.moc:126
#12 0x00002ba63499e4ee in QObject::activate_signal (this=0xeaafe0,
clist=0xe7f4d0, o=0x7fff781b02f0) at kernel/qobject.cpp:2356
#13 0x00002ba63a11b4f2 in KIO::Job::result (this=<value optimized out>,
t0=0xeaafe0) at ./jobclasses.moc:162
#14 0x00002ba63a155a7f in KIO::Job::emitResult (this=0xeaafe0)
at /build/buildd/kdelibs-3.5.7.dfsg.1/./kio/kio/job.cpp:235
#15 0x00002ba63a160dda in KIO::SimpleJob::slotFinished (this=0xeaafe0)
at /build/buildd/kdelibs-3.5.7.dfsg.1/./kio/kio/job.cpp:601
#16 0x00002ba63a16142a in KIO::TransferJob::slotFinished (this=0xeaafe0)
at /build/buildd/kdelibs-3.5.7.dfsg.1/./kio/kio/job.cpp:971
#17 0x00002ba63a1556e8 in KIO::TransferJob::qt_invoke (this=0xeaafe0, _id=17,
_o=0x7fff781b0840) at ./jobclasses.moc:1071
#18 0x00002ba63499e4ee in QObject::activate_signal (this=0xbbf9f0,
clist=0xeeb950, o=0x7fff781b0840) at kernel/qobject.cpp:2356
#19 0x00002ba63499f088 in QObject::activate_signal (this=0xbbf9f0, signal=6)
at kernel/qobject.cpp:2325
#20 0x00002ba63a1817a5 in KIO::SlaveInterface::dispatch (this=0xbbf9f0,
_cmd=104, rawdata=@0x7fff781b0b20)
at /build/buildd/kdelibs-3.5.7.dfsg.1/./kio/kio/slaveinterface.cpp:243
#21 0x00002ba63a1723de in KIO::SlaveInterface::dispatch (this=0xbbf9f0)
at /build/buildd/kdelibs-3.5.7.dfsg.1/./kio/kio/slaveinterface.cpp:173
#22 0x00002ba63a12a76b in KIO::Slave::gotInput (this=0x0)
at /build/buildd/kdelibs-3.5.7.dfsg.1/./kio/kio/slave.cpp:300
#23 0x00002ba63a173958 in KIO::Slave::qt_invoke (this=0xbbf9f0, _id=4,
_o=0x7fff781b0ce0) at ./slave.moc:113
#24 0x00002ba63499e4ee in QObject::activate_signal (this=0xbbc940,
clist=0xbbc3f0, o=0x7fff781b0ce0) at kernel/qobject.cpp:2356
#25 0x00002ba63499eedf in QObject::activate_signal (this=0xbbc940, signal=2,
param=23) at kernel/qobject.cpp:2449
#26 0x00002ba634d0d364 in QSocketNotifier::activated (this=0xbbc940, t0=23)
at .moc/debug-shared-mt/moc_qsocketnotifier.cpp:85
#27 0x00002ba6349bfedc in QSocketNotifier::event (this=0xbbc940,
e=0x7fff781b11d0) at kernel/qsocketnotifier.cpp:258
#28 0x00002ba634939842 in QApplication::internalNotify (this=0x7fff781b1560,
receiver=0xbbc940, e=0x7fff781b11d0) at kernel/qapplication.cpp:2635
#29 0x00002ba63493b5f0 in QApplication::notify (this=0x7fff781b1560,
receiver=0xbbc940, e=0x7fff781b11d0) at kernel/qapplication.cpp:2358
#30 0x00002ba63405d438 in KApplication::notify (this=0x7fff781b1560,
receiver=0xbbc940, event=0x7fff781b11d0)
at /build/buildd/kdelibs-3.5.7.dfsg.1/./kdecore/kapplication.cpp:550
#31 0x00002ba6348cc7f2 in QApplication::sendEvent (receiver=0xbbc940,
event=0x7fff781b11d0) at ../include/qapplication.h:520
#32 0x00002ba63492c487 in QEventLoop::activateSocketNotifiers (this=0x6635f0)
at kernel/qeventloop_unix.cpp:578
#33 0x00002ba6348e0846 in QEventLoop::processEvents (this=0x6635f0, flags=4)
at kernel/qeventloop_x11.cpp:383
#34 0x00002ba634952e27 in QEventLoop::enterLoop (this=0x6635f0)
at kernel/qeventloop.cpp:198
#35 0x00002ba634952c2f in QEventLoop::exec (this=0x6635f0)
at kernel/qeventloop.cpp:145
#36 0x00002ba63493b324 in QApplication::exec (this=0x7fff781b1560)
at kernel/qapplication.cpp:2758
#37 0x0000000000402aed in main (argc=<value optimized out>,
argv=<value optimized out>)
at /build/buildd/kdepim-3.5.7/./kmail/main.cpp:110
#38 0x00002ba633b38b04 in __libc_start_main () from /lib/libc.so.6
#39 0x0000000000402879 in _start ()
-- System Information:
Debian Release: lenny/sid
APT prefers testing
APT policy: (990, 'testing'), (500, 'unstable'), (500, 'stable'), (1, 'experimental')
Architecture: amd64 (x86_64)
Kernel: Linux 2.6.23-rc1-melech (SMP w/2 CPU cores; PREEMPT)
Locale: LANG=sv_SE.UTF-8, LC_CTYPE=sv_SE.UTF-8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/bash
Versions of packages kmail depends on:
ii kdebase-kio-plugins 4:3.5.7-2 core I/O slaves for KDE
ii kdelibs4c2a 4:3.5.7.dfsg.1-1 core libraries and binaries for al
ii kdepim-kio-plugins 4:3.5.7-2 KDE pim I/O Slaves
ii libart-2.0-2 2.3.19-3 Library of functions for 2D graphi
ii libaudio2 1.9-2+b1 The Network Audio System (NAS). (s
ii libc6 2.6-2 GNU C Library: Shared libraries
ii libfontconfig1 2.4.2-1.2 generic font configuration library
ii libfreetype6 2.3.5-1+b1 FreeType 2 font engine, shared lib
ii libgcc1 1:4.2-20070712-1 GCC support library
ii libice6 1:1.0.3-2 X11 Inter-Client Exchange library
ii libidn11 0.6.5-1 GNU libidn library, implementation
ii libjpeg62 6b-13 The Independent JPEG Group's JPEG
ii libkcal2b 4:3.5.7-2 KDE calendaring library
ii libkdepim1a 4:3.5.7-2 KDE PIM library
ii libkleopatra1 4:3.5.7-2 KDE GnuPG interface libraries
ii libkmime2 4:3.5.7-2 KDE MIME interface library
ii libkpimidentities1 4:3.5.7-2 KDE PIM user identity information
ii libksieve0 4:3.5.7-2 KDE mail/news message filtering li
ii libmimelib1c2a 4:3.5.7-2 KDE mime library
ii libpng12-0 1.2.15~beta5-2 PNG library - runtime
ii libqt3-mt 3:3.3.7-5 Qt GUI Library (Threaded runtime v
ii libsm6 2:1.0.3-1+b1 X11 Session Management library
ii libstdc++6 4.2-20070712-1 The GNU Standard C++ Library v3
ii libx11-6 2:1.0.3-7 X11 client-side library
ii libxcursor1 1:1.1.8-2 X cursor management library
ii libxext6 1:1.0.3-2 X11 miscellaneous extension librar
ii libxft2 2.1.12-2 FreeType-based font drawing librar
ii libxi6 2:1.1.1-1 X11 Input extension library
ii libxinerama1 1:1.0.2-1 X11 Xinerama extension library
ii libxrandr2 2:1.2.1-1 X11 RandR extension library
ii libxrender1 1:0.9.2-1 X Rendering Extension client libra
ii libxt6 1:1.0.5-3 X11 toolkit intrinsics library
ii perl 5.8.8-7 Larry Wall's Practical Extraction
ii zlib1g 1:1.2.3.3.dfsg-5 compression library - runtime
Versions of packages kmail recommends:
ii procmail 3.22-16 Versatile e-mail processor
-- no debconf information
--- End Message ---
--- Begin Message ---
Version: 4:4.2.2-1
I think this is fixed in newer versions.
/Sune
--
How could I save the AGP forward?
You must receive the mailer, this way then from the options inside Flash MX
you neither can ever send a RW mailer, nor must cancel a GPU but you should
link with the digital ISA kernel on the connection of a application over a 3D
button to the clock, so that from Netscape XP you either cannot mount a MIDI
pointer, or need to cancel the gadget, so that then you can never turn on the
level-8 modem.
--- End Message ---